#2cfb8e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2cfb8e is composed of 17.3% red, 98.4%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.4%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 148.4 degrees, a saturation of 96.3% and a lightness of 57.8%. #2cfb8e color hex could be obtained by blending #58ffff with #00f71d.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

#2cfb8e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2cfb8e has RGB values of R:44, G:251,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 2947982.
